Output 56b356b4a79e7461229f4e04c5a81d2d5290384fd75a804c71300bd2a2df938c:2

value
149342906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65385c4a55c93bc2bd4fb680b46c86475a41522b OP_EQUAL
address
3AvDgv3sFeEcUUJJjddr3Ld4PvPh2Sczag
transaction
56b356b4a79e7461229f4e04c5a81d2d5290384fd75a804c71300bd2a2df938c
spent
true